Amazon is the leading online retailer and marketplace for third party sellers. Retail related revenue represents approximately 74% of total, followed by Amazon Web Services (17%), and advertising services (9%). International segments constitute 22% of Amazon's total revenue, led by Germany, the United Kingdom, and Japan.

Greg Abel, Warren Buffett's successor as CEO of Berkshire Hathaway, has made sig...
Greg Abel, Warren Buffett's successor as CEO of Berkshire Hathaway, has made significant portfolio changes in his first quarter. He completely exited Berkshire's Amazon position (2.3M shares) to lock in profits, citing the stock's expensive valuation. Simultaneously, Abel more than tripled Berkshire's stake in Alphabet, making it a top-five holding, attracted by its dominant search monopoly, AI growth potential, and more attractive valuation compared to Amazon.
